116TH CONGRESS
1ST SESSION H. R. 1238
To direct the Secretary of Agriculture to treat certain planted soybean crops
as harvested commodity crops under the Market Facilitation Program.
IN TH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ES
FEBRUARY 14, 2019
Mr. ABRAHAM (for himself, Mr. ESTES, Mr. KELLY of Mississippi, and Mr.
GUEST) introduced the following bill; which was referred to the Com-
mittee on Agriculture
A BILL
To direct the Secretary of Agriculture to treat certain plant-
ed soybean crops as harvested commodity crops under
the Market Facilitation Program.
